Official abstract text for this publication.
A combined wheel includes spokes, steel bushings, a rim, a brake pad, pins and a backing ring. The spokes are placed in respective empty slots between adjacent connecting blocks, and clamping grooves therein are matched with the connecting blocks. The pins are installed into holes of the spokes and the connecting blocks. A left end face of a backing ring is matched with the back of the spokes. A plurality of screws connect the backing ring, the connecting blocks and the spokes and are fitted into the steel bushings. The brake pad is fixed to two pluralities of bosses by a second plurality of screws. In use of the combined wheel, both radial force and axial force generated in the running of the wheel can be counteracted on the spokes. The annular brake pad is installed on the inner wall of the rim, thereby increasing the brake radius.

The invention claimed is: 1. A combined wheel, comprising spokes, steel bushings, first screws, a rim, second screws, a brake pad, pins and a backing ring, wherein the steel bushings are installed in step grooves of the spokes; connecting blocks are uniformly distributed in a circumferential direction of the rim and are integrated with the rim, with an arc length formed by a first empty slot between every two adjacent connecting blocks being greater than a length of the connecting block; clamping grooves in the spokes are matched with the connecting blocks respectively; the pins are matched with the spokes and the connecting blocks; a left end face of the backing ring is matched with backs of the spokes; the first screws connect the backing ring, the connecting blocks and the spokes together and are matched with the steel bushings; and first bosses and second bosses are both integrated with the rim, the first bosses are arranged to be symmetric about a center of the rim, and the second bosses are also arranged to be symmetric about the center of the rim, with a second empty slot being reserved between each group of the first boss and the second boss in an axial direction of the rim; the first bosses and the second bosses are each uniformly distributed on an inner side of the rim in the circumferential direction of the rim; and the brake pad is annular and is fixed to both the first bosses and the second bosses by the second screws.
